02502 German Infantry Ardens WW II Whilst it may have looked at the beginning of World War II that the German Wehrmacht's initial successes were due to the interaction of tanks and air force, the main burden of the fighting throughout the war was borne by the ordinary foot soldier. The German infantry marched from the coast of France to the vast Russian plains.
